The Secret Behind Dye Matching

Indian rugs often use natural dyes — extracted from plants, minerals, and insects — that fade gracefully over time. However, replacing or repairing damaged sections means matching those dyes with astonishing accuracy. Professionals performing Indian rug repair in Vista spend hours creating custom color blends to ensure repaired sections blend seamlessly with the original design.

This process isn’t just about aesthetics. Poorly matched dyes can lead to uneven fading or color bleeding, especially during rug cleaning. A master restorer knows how to test fibers, balance pH, and stabilize colors before any cleaning or repair begins. That’s what makes true rug restoration such a delicate and specialized craft.

Weave Precision: Bringing Old Rugs Back to Life

When repairing torn sections or holes, every thread counts. Indian rugs are known for their detailed weaving — often with thousands of knots per square inch. Skilled technicians replicate these patterns using the same techniques as traditional artisans.

This step can take days or even weeks, depending on the rug’s size and damage. But the result? A rug that not only looks beautiful again but retains its structure and strength for generations to come. Whether it’s a silk rug from Jaipur or a wool creation from Agra, rug repair professionals ensure the original craftsmanship is respected in every stitch.

The Role of Cleaning Before and After Repair

Many clients are surprised to learn that cleaning is a crucial part of the repair process. Before restoration begins, the rug must be thoroughly washed to remove dirt, oils, and allergens that could interfere with new threads or adhesives. After repairs are complete, gentle rug cleaning helps even out texture and tone, giving your rug a refreshed, balanced look.

Professionals specializing in Indian rug repair in Vista use soft brushes, filtered water, and pH-balanced solutions — never harsh chemicals or machines. This ensures that every rug, no matter how old or fragile, receives the care it deserves.

1. Inspect Regularly — Catch Problems Early

Antique rugs don’t always show damage right away. You might notice a slightly uneven edge or a thread that looks out of place. Make it a habit to inspect your rug every few months, especially the corners and fringes. These areas are most vulnerable to wear and unraveling.

If you notice fraying or small holes, don’t delay. Early detection can save you from costly full restorations later. Professional rug experts can easily re-knot or reweave the affected sections if they’re caught in time.

2. Clean Before Repair

Before any repair work, ensure the rug is thoroughly cleaned. Dirt, dust, and oils can mask damage or make repair threads difficult to blend. Always opt for professional rug cleaning instead of DIY methods. Antique rugs need gentle hand washing using pH-balanced cleaners that protect natural dyes.

When you bring your rug in for Indian rug repair in Rancho Bernardo, cleaning is usually the first step in the process. It allows technicians to see the true colors and the extent of the damage, ensuring accurate restoration work.

3. Know When to Reweave and When to Patch

Not all rug damage needs full reweaving. For minor tears, patching or reinforcing the backing might be sufficient. However, for antique rugs where design continuity is important, reweaving with matching fibers is often the better option.

Skilled rug restoration specialists can match the color, texture, and knot style of the original rug — preserving its historical and aesthetic value. If you’re unsure which repair type is best, a professional evaluation can guide you toward the most cost-effective and authentic solution.

4. Protect Against Moths and Moisture

Two of the biggest enemies of antique rugs are moths and moisture. Store your rug in a cool, dry space, and avoid placing it directly on concrete floors. If possible, use a cotton sheet or rug pad underneath to allow air circulation.

Every six months, vacuum the back of your rug and inspect for signs of moth activity. If you find powdery residue or thinning areas, it’s time to call in professionals for inspection and treatment. Regular maintenance and Indian rug repair in Rancho Bernardo can keep these issues from becoming long-term damage.

5. Rotate and Rest Your Rugs

Collectors often display rugs in living rooms or hallways where they receive foot traffic and sunlight exposure. Over time, this can cause uneven fading or fiber fatigue. To prevent this, rotate your rugs every few months and give them rest periods in low-traffic areas.

This simple step helps distribute wear evenly and keeps the pile from flattening. Combined with periodic rug cleaning and timely repairs, it will extend the life of your antique rug for many more years.

Regional Differences in Indian Rugs

India’s weaving traditions stretch across centuries and are as varied as its geography. A rug made in Kashmir may look and feel very different from one woven in Rajasthan or Uttar Pradesh. These differences aren’t just aesthetic—they affect how a rug must be cleaned, repaired, and preserved.

Some common regional styles include:

  • Kashmiri rugs: Famous for their silk or fine wool pile, delicate floral motifs, and intricate knotting techniques.

  • Jaipur and Agra rugs: Known for dense knotting and rich Persian-inspired designs with deep reds and blues.

  • Bhadohi rugs (from Uttar Pradesh): Often larger and more durable, featuring bold patterns and earthy tones.

  • Tribal and village rugs: Typically woven with coarser wool, featuring geometric or symbolic patterns.

Each of these styles uses different fibers, dyes, and knotting methods—all of which determine the repair approach.

How Weaving Style Impacts Repair

When a rug expert evaluates an Indian rug for repair, the first thing they consider is its region of origin. Here’s why that matters:

  1. Fiber type – Kashmir rugs often use silk, which requires ultra-gentle handling. Village rugs may use coarse wool, which is more durable but harder to match during repairs.

  2. Knot density – Fine Kashmiri rugs can have hundreds of knots per square inch, making repairs time-consuming and requiring extreme precision. By contrast, a Bhadohi rug’s looser weave allows faster repairs but demands strong reinforcement.

  3. Design complexity – Floral patterns need seamless color-matching to maintain flow, while geometric tribal designs require precise alignment of shapes and lines.

  4. Dye sources – Many Indian rugs use natural vegetable dyes. Repair experts must carefully test dyes to avoid bleeding during washing or re-dyeing.

Common Rug Repair Needs

No matter the style, Indian rugs often need similar types of repair:

  • Fringe restoration to prevent unraveling.

  • Edge reinforcement where borders have frayed.

  • Pile re-weaving in worn or damaged areas.

  • Color correction for faded or stained sections.

But the techniques for each depend heavily on the rug’s regional weaving style. For example, re-weaving silk threads on a Kashmiri rug requires thinner needles and magnification tools, while reinforcing a Bhadohi rug’s edge may involve sturdier wool and heavier stitching.
